Dental Practice Management Software Market Size, Share Outlook, Growth Analysis Report and Forecast Trends 2026-2030

The global Dental Practice Management Software market provides digital tools for managing dental clinic operations, including appointment scheduling, billing, patient records, and insurance processing. Market size estimates for 2025 vary across industry trackers, ranging from approximately $1.25 billion to $3.18 billion, with the sector generally growing at a compound annual rate between 8.4% and 11.4%. Key growth drivers include the shift from paper-based to electronic health records, rising demand for cloud-based solutions, and increasing regulatory requirements for data management and billing accuracy. The market is consolidating around integrated platforms that combine practice management with clinical and patient engagement tools.

Market Overview

Dental Practice Management Software streamlines administrative workflows for dental clinics, from scheduling and billing to insurance claims processing and patient communication. The market encompasses both cloud-based and on-premise deployments serving solo practitioners, group practices, and large dental service organizations. While no government statistical agency publishes an official market size for this software segment, industry analysts consistently estimate 2025 global revenue in the $1.25 billion to $3.18 billion range, reflecting the sector's rapid digitization across dental care markets.

  • Software solutions integrate electronic health records, practice analytics, and patient engagement modules
  • North America currently represents the largest regional market share due to high dental IT adoption rates
  • Market size estimates vary significantly across research firms due to differences in product scope and methodology

Growth Drivers

The transition from paper-based systems to electronic health records continues to fuel adoption, particularly as dental practices seek to improve operational efficiency and reduce administrative overhead. Regulatory pressures, including compliance with health data privacy standards and insurance billing requirements, make specialized software increasingly essential. Rising patient expectations for online appointment booking, digital communication, and transparent billing are pushing practices toward modern practice management platforms that integrate patient-facing digital experiences.

  • Growing dental service organization model adoption favors centralized, multi-location software platforms
  • Integration of artificial intelligence for scheduling optimization and revenue cycle management
  • Expanding dental insurance coverage and complex reimbursement rules require automated claims processing

Segmentation and Regional Analysis

The market splits primarily between cloud-based software, which dominates new deployments due to lower upfront costs and remote accessibility, and on-premise solutions favored by larger practices with specific data security requirements. By end-user segment, solo and small group practices represent the largest category, though dental service organizations and multi-site clinics are the fastest-growing segment as industry consolidation accelerates. Geographically, North America leads market share, while Asia-Pacific is projected to grow at the highest rates as dental care infrastructure expands in emerging economies.

  • Cloud deployments are outpacing on-premise installations by approximately 2:1 in new sales
  • Europe and Asia-Pacific together account for over 35% of global market revenue
  • Software priced per provider per month remains the dominant licensing model

Trends and Outlook

Artificial intelligence and machine learning capabilities are increasingly embedded in practice management platforms for predictive scheduling, revenue cycle optimization, and automated patient follow-up. Interoperability standards and API-driven integrations are becoming critical as practices connect practice management software with clinical imaging systems, lab ordering platforms, and third-party patient communication tools. Industry consolidation among dental practices and continued platform convergence suggest the market will maintain mid-to-high single-digit growth through the early 2030s, with cloud-native vendors gaining share against legacy on-premise systems.

  • Real-time eligibility verification and automated claim scrubbing are reducing practice revenue leakage
  • Mobile practice management applications are expanding to support remote administrative work
  • Vendor consolidation through acquisition is expected to continue as buyers seek all-in-one practice ecosystems
